This is not a bad drawing at all, however, without the title you gave it I'm not sure I'd recognize this as a "heroic" character. If anything, the dark clothing and the skull logo on the shirt give the appearance of a villanous character. Also, the pose is kind of casual. Heroes tend to have a strong pose, like with their chests puffed out or their muscles tensed. They look primed for action. It's kind of hard to make out the face at this size, but I think a stronger jaw and lighter eyes would also help add to the heroic effect you're going for. I hope I'm making sense. If you don't really care if it's heroic or not and just slapped that title on then ignore me, because it's a good drawing. If you want this to be something people can look at with no background information and immediately identify as a hero, then you have to play to some of the cliches that people tend to expect from heroic characters.
